    Its difficult to recreate organic stuff you may be better off using a sculpting program, which is not really my forte, Also I suppose you could not really cast them if they were mixed metals? Its just another tool I suppose, Its great at somethings but not so good at others, There is also more clean up associated with CAD and printed models you get grow lines that are a pain to remove in tricky spots. I will have a go at the organic rings if I get a chance just to see. You can apply textures to the renders. But on the cad you struggle to keep them if you want a polished surface
